Sun-Kissed Palette

Color is a powerful tool in interior design, and it can significantly impact the mood and feel of a space. Summer begs for a warm and inviting atmosphere, and you can achieve this by embracing a sun-kissed palette.

  • Warm Hues: Light yellows, corals, and peaches evoke feelings of sunshine and warmth. You don’t need to repaint your entire living room. Consider incorporating these colors through throw pillows, accent furniture, or artwork. A coral-colored accent chair or a collection of decorative pillows in sunshine yellow can add a touch of summer cheer.
  • Cool Accents: Balance the warm tones with pops of cool colors like turquoise, seafoam green, or light blue. These hues create a sense of airiness and mimic the refreshing feeling of summer breezes. A turquoise throw rug or seafoam green accent wall can be the perfect interior elements to add a touch of coastal cool to your space.
  • Natural Inspiration: Draw inspiration from the natural world beyond your window. Light, earthy tones like beige or light brown can represent elements like sand and stone. These colors create a sense of groundedness and complement the overall summery vibe. Consider a woven beige rug or light brown accent chair to bring the outdoors in.

Let the Light In

Summer is synonymous with sunshine, and maximizing natural light is an essential part of creating a bright and cheerful atmosphere in your home. Here are some tips:

  • Maximize Natural Light: Open your curtains and blinds wide during the day to allow natural light to flood your space. If overgrown trees are blocking sunlight from your windows, consider trimming them back to allow more sunshine in.
  • Strategic Lamp Placement: Evenings still require light, and well-placed lamps can create a warm and inviting ambiance. Floor lamps in the corners of the room can provide general lighting, while table lamps can add focused light for reading or working. Consider sconces along hallways or above accent furniture to add a touch of warm light.
  • Embrace Sheer Fabrics: Sheer curtains or blinds allow natural light to filter through while maintaining some privacy. This creates a sense of openness and airiness, perfect for summer. Sheer linen curtains are a great option as they’re lightweight and breathable.

Natural Textures & Breezy Materials

Interior elements with natural textures and light, breezy materials can add a touch of summer to your space.

  • Woven Wonders: Woven textures like wicker, rattan, or jute add a natural, summery touch and bring the outdoors inside. Consider incorporating these elements through furniture pieces like accent chairs or ottomans. Wicker baskets are also great for storage and can add a casual vibe. You can even find woven wall hangings to add a touch of bohemian flair.
  • Light and Breezy Fabrics: Fabrics like linen, cotton, and sheer voile can add a light and airy feel to your space. These breathable materials are perfect for summer as they allow air to circulate and keep things cool. Use them for curtains, throw pillows, or even tablecloths. A light cotton throw blanket on your couch adds both comfort and texture.
  • Nature-Inspired Patterns: Patterns inspired by nature can add a touch of summer whimsy. Floral prints, tropical motifs, or even nautical themes can work well. The key is to use them strategically to avoid overwhelming the space. Consider floral throw pillows or a patterned accent rug to add a touch of summer flair.

Summer Scents & Sounds

Our sense of smell is powerful, and it can significantly impact our mood. Summer scents can evoke feelings of relaxation and vacation vibes.

  • Aromatherapy for Ambiance: Diffusers or scented candles with summery fragrances like citrus, coconut, or fresh linen can create a relaxing and inviting atmosphere. Citrus scents are uplifting and invigorating, while coconut and fresh linen evoke feelings of a beach vacation.
  • Bring the Outdoors In: Let the sounds of nature add to the summer ambiance. Play calming nature sounds like ocean waves or birds chirping in the background. Nature sounds can be especially effective when used in conjunction with summer scents to create a truly immersive experience.
